A Fort Being Built to Protect Augsburg

1703-1741

Physical Qualities Etching, Sheet: 271 x 416 mm. (10 11/16 x 16 3/8 in.) Plate: 254 x 400 mm. (10 x 15 3/4 in.)
Credit Line Garrett Collection
Object Number 1946.112.13387
One from a series of six etchings depicting the Siege of Augsburg. Four prints from the series are in the Garrett Collection (1946.112.13386 - 1946.112.13389).

Inscribed: Recto: below image, lower center, in plate "4."; below image, across lower margin, in plate, two columns of text in Latin and German, two lines each, begining "Coemeterio Evangelicorum [...]"; below image, lower left, in plate "Georg Philip Rugendas Pictor del. et fecit."; below image, lower center, in plate "Cum Privileg. Sac. Caes. Majest."; below image, lower right, in plate "Ierem. Wolff excud. Aug. Vind."
